iOS Control Center Hidden Buttons

Monday November 19, 2018. 03:00 PM , from MacMost
The Control Center on iOS is very useful, yet many people don't use it to quickly access common functions. There are many buttons that you can add to Control Center that add even more. If you have an iPhone or iPad you should take the time to look at all of the buttons to get the most from your device.

One of the most useful parts of iOS is the Control Center. But a lot of people don't use it very much. You really should get used to using it. It's a great way to access many of the functions on your iPhone and iPad.

One the iPhone X here you just drag down from the top right corner of the screen to bring up Control Center. Now there's some default things in here like the ability to control your music, go into Airplane mode, turn on Do Not Disturb, adjust the volume and screen brightness. But in addition to that there are these buttons at the bottom that are customizable. So you should familiarize yourself with the ones that you have there. Like, for instance, the ability to turn the Flashlight on, change the font size, you know go to the Camera app or Calculator app, start a Stopwatch. All of that's there.

But you should also not ignore the ones that you may not have added. If you go into Settings and under Settings you look for Control Center and you'll see Customize Controls. Here you'll see, at the top, the ones that are already included. So I can see them and I can see actually what they are called in addition to their icons. So, for instance, I can see that the red one is called Screen Recording and that's for screen recording.

But there's a whole bunch more at the bottom. This will depend upon which model you're looking at. You know iPhone or iPad and which model of iPhone. So there's a whole bunch of stuff in here. For instance you can turn on Do Not Disturb While Driving with this. You can go to the Home app. You can turn on Low Power Mode, turn it on and off really easily. Magnifier. You can jump to Notes. You can Scan QR Code. You can go to a Stopwatch or Voice Memos. Even access your Wallet here inside of Control Center as long as you enable these.

So just tap one to add it. So if I wanted to tap Alarm there you can see now its added here. I can also drag the little three line handle on the right to move them around and set the order for them. Now that I've added Alarm here I can go Home again and I can see Alarm has been added there. So it's really handy.

Here on my older iPad Pro I see there's slightly different ones available there. So go through these as well. Whatever device you've got I encourage you to actually go through each one of these, add them, maybe add them all and just try them out and then remove the ones you don't think you'll use because it really could be handy and a much better experience using your iOS device if you have the right buttons in Control Center and you know what they are and you start using them.
